官术网_书友最值得收藏!

2.3.3 var變量及其聲明

在JDK 10中引入了局部類型變量推斷,也就是var關(guān)鍵字,之前var關(guān)鍵字更多地使用在JavaScript中,并不需要指定變量的數(shù)據(jù)類型。在使用var關(guān)鍵字來聲明變量時(shí),不需指定該變量的類型,編譯器能根據(jù)右邊的表達(dá)式來自動(dòng)判斷類型,這樣可以減少代碼的冗余,更便于閱讀。

在引入var關(guān)鍵字之前,變量聲明方式如下:

    String name = "孫悟空";
    int age = 500;

在引入var關(guān)鍵字以后,無須在表達(dá)式左邊指定變量類型,采用“var 變量名 = 值”格式即可,具體示例如下:

    var name = "齊天大圣";
    var age = 500;

注意:使用var聲明變量時(shí),必須同時(shí)賦初值,不能拆成兩行語(yǔ)句;var只能聲明局部變量,不能用于聲明方法的返回值類型、類的成員變量。

主站蜘蛛池模板: 左贡县| 盐边县| 嘉禾县| 阿拉善左旗| 永川市| 大港区| 南康市| 南投县| 马关县| 乾安县| 农安县| 四子王旗| 东丰县| 柞水县| 南漳县| 锦州市| 定边县| 额尔古纳市| 鄂托克前旗| 内乡县| 特克斯县| 长武县| 颍上县| 遵义县| 扎鲁特旗| 额敏县| 周宁县| 威信县| 垣曲县| 福州市| 乳源| 定结县| 沾化县| 科技| 赤峰市| 五原县| 贺兰县| 清苑县| 吉林省| 明溪县| 苍山县|